Let Royals pay the £2m wedding cost

- Edited by FIONA PARKER

■ There’s only one way to describe the royals, and that’s selfish. It’s a disgrace that they expect taxpayers to pay for the security and clean-up after Eugenie’s wedding.

Didn’t we pay enough for Harry’s nuptials? How many people could be taken off the street and housed with this money, and how many NHS operations could be paid for?

The royals know only too well the dire straits our country is in, but they just don’t care.

For a wealthy family who could easily support themselves they are a disgrace, and we are all fools to keep supporting them in the lavish lifestyle they are accustomed to.

Sally Young Wells-next-the-Sea, Norfolk

■ I can’t believe the furore over the cost of Princess Eugenie’s wedding. It’s the same as any other public event, whether it be a political rally or a celebratio­n or festival.

In my opinion, what the Royal Family brings into this country in terms of tourism and prestige more than makes up for any outlay by the taxpayers. I bet there are plenty of people cheering on the happy couple tomorrow. Kerry Jaymes South London
